Final Fantasy Type-0 originally launched on the PSP in Japan in 2011. For years, English-speaking fans relied on an unofficial translation patch (often referred to as the “English Patched v2” by the fan group SkyBladeCloud) to play the game on PSP emulators or modded hardware. The English patch for Final Fantasy Type-0 was a fan-made translation that allowed players outside of Japan to experience the game in their native language. The patch, particularly version 2, is renowned for its comprehensive translation, fixing various bugs, and enhancing the gameplay experience. This patch is a testament to the dedication of the fan community, ensuring that more players could enjoy this unique installment of the Final Fantasy series.
